Meaning of retorting
The primary meaning of the word "retorting" is to respond to someone or something, often in a sharp or witty manner.
Etymology of retorting
The word "retorting" comes from the Old French word "retorter", which means "to twist or turn back", and the Latin word "retortus", which is the past participle of "retorquere", meaning "to twist or turn back"
The word has been used in English since the 15th century to describe the act of responding or replying to someone or something

Definitions
- To respond to someone or something, often in a sharp or witty manner
- * To reply to a remark, comment, or criticism, often with a clever or sarcastic comment
- * To return a comment, remark, or criticism, often with the intention of defending oneself or one's position
Usage Examples
- She retorted to his comment with a witty remark that left the room in stitches
- * He retorted to the criticism by defending his position and explaining his reasoning
- * The company retorted to the allegations by issuing a statement denying any wrongdoing
